About the role
Council is seeking a motivated professional to help shape the future of our digital services.
This is a dynamic opportunity to be part of a forward-thinking team, where your insights and technical know-how will contribute to smarter, more efficient systems that support our community and staff every day.
Reporting to the Coordinator Business Systems, your duties will include, but are not limited to:
- Support the implementation, maintenance, and continuous improvement of Council’s corporate business systems
- Collaborate with stakeholders and vendors to plan, test, and deliver system enhancements and upgrades
- Analyse business needs and develop system specifications that support operational efficiency
- Provide technical support and training to end users, ensuring systems are used effectively and confidently
- Develop and maintain user documentation, training materials, and standard operating procedures
- Design and deliver data-driven reports and dashboards to support decision-making across the organisation
- Ensure secure and compliant access management for business systems in line with Council protocols
Qualifications, Skills & Experience
- Relevant degree or equivalent demonstrated experience in a similar role
- Proven experience in information management service delivery and system implementation
- Experience in Local Government systems, ideally with TechnologyOne and Bookable platforms
- Strong problem-solving, analytical, and decision-making skills
- Excellent communication and interpersonal skills, with the ability to engage across all levels of the organisation
- Strong time management and organisational skills
- Current C Class driver’s licence
